Description
Two bodies lie outside the Khogyani police barracks; the victims of a suicide bombing targeting an Afghan National Police counter narcotics convoy travelling through the region.
Photographer Stephen Dupont records this incident in his diary entry for 6 May 2008, "Streams of blood flowed in everywhere direction, making patterns in the dirt".
This image was taken by photographer Stephen Dupont who, along with journalist Paul Raffaele, was travelling with the counter narcotics convoy when it was hit by a 12 year old suicide bomber. Dupont suffered superficial wounds and shock from the impact but continued to document the devastation of the bombing before being transferred to the US air base in Jalalabad for treatment.
